1. Key Features to Look For
When you’re shopping, keep these important features in mind. They make a big difference in how well an air purifier works.
HEPA Filters
HEPA stands for High-Efficiency Particulate Air. A true HEPA filter captures at least 99.97% of tiny particles. These include dust, pollen, pet dander, and mold spores. For a 1000 sq ft space, you want a purifier with a powerful HEPA filter.
Activated Carbon Filters
These filters are great for getting rid of smells. They absorb odors from cooking, pets, and smoke. If you have allergies or strong smells in your home, this filter is a must-have.
CADR (Clean Air Delivery Rate)
CADR tells you how quickly an air purifier cleans the air. It has ratings for smoke, dust, and pollen. A higher CADR means it cleans the air faster. For 1000 sq ft, you’ll need a purifier with a high CADR to cover the whole area effectively.
Room Size Coverage
Check the product’s specifications for the recommended room size. Make sure it’s designed for at least 1000 sq ft or larger. Some purifiers are rated for smaller rooms, and they won’t do a good job in a big space.
Noise Level
Air purifiers have fans, and fans make noise. Look for models with low decibel (dB) ratings, especially if you plan to use it in a bedroom or living area. Many purifiers have a “sleep mode” that runs quieter at night.
Smart Features
Some air purifiers come with smart features. These can include Wi-Fi connectivity, app control, and air quality sensors. You can often monitor air quality and adjust settings from your phone. Some models even adjust their fan speed automatically based on the air quality.

3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Several things can make an air purifier better or worse.
Quality Boosters
- Multiple Filter Stages: A purifier with a pre-filter, HEPA filter, and carbon filter works best. The pre-filter catches larger particles, extending the life of the HEPA filter.
- Good Airflow Design: The way the air flows through the purifier matters. A good design allows air to enter and exit efficiently.
- Filter Replacement Indicator: This feature tells you when it’s time to change the filters. It helps maintain optimal performance.
Quality Reducers
- Ozone Emission: Some purifiers produce ozone as a byproduct. Ozone can irritate your lungs. Look for purifiers that are certified as low or no ozone-producing.
- Cheaply Made Filters: Filters that aren’t well-made won’t capture as many pollutants. This means the air won’t be as clean.
- Poor Sealing: If the air can escape around the filters, it won’t be cleaned properly. A good seal is essential.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: How often do I need to replace the filters?
A: Filter replacement frequency depends on the model and how often you use the purifier. Most manufacturers recommend replacing HEPA filters every 6-12 months and carbon filters every 3-6 months. Always check your purifier’s manual for specific guidance.
Q: Will an air purifier make my electricity bill go up a lot?
A: Air purifiers use electricity, but most modern units are quite energy-efficient. The amount they add to your bill is usually small, especially if you use energy-saving modes.
Q: Can I wash the HEPA filter?
A: Generally, you cannot wash HEPA filters. They are designed to trap very fine particles, and washing them can damage their structure and reduce their effectiveness. Always check your manual; some pre-filters might be washable.
Q: Are air purifiers noisy?
A: Air purifiers do make some noise due to the fan. However, many models offer different fan speeds, including a quiet “sleep mode” for nighttime use. Look for models with low decibel ratings.
Q: What is an air purifier’s CADR rating?
A: CADR stands for Clean Air Delivery Rate. It measures how quickly an air purifier can remove specific pollutants like smoke, dust, and pollen from the air. A higher CADR means faster cleaning.
Q: Do I need a separate air purifier for each room?
A: For a 1000 sq ft space, one powerful air purifier designed for that size is usually sufficient for the main living area. However, if you have very distinct areas or specific needs (like a nursery or a home office), you might consider smaller units for those specific rooms.
Q: Can an air purifier help with pet allergies?
A: Yes! Air purifiers with HEPA filters are excellent at capturing pet dander, which is a common allergen. Activated carbon filters also help remove pet odors.
Q: What does “true HEPA” mean?
A: “True HEPA” means the filter meets a strict standard, capturing at least 99.97% of airborne particles that are 0.3 microns in size. This is the most effective type of HEPA filter.
Q: How do I know if an air purifier is effective for my 1000 sq ft home?
A: Check the manufacturer’s specifications for the recommended room size coverage. Ensure the purifier is rated for at least 1000 sq ft and has a high CADR rating. A higher CADR means it can clean the air in a larger space more quickly.
Q: Should I leave my air purifier on all the time?
A: For continuous air quality improvement, it’s generally recommended to leave your air purifier on. Many models are energy-efficient, and running them constantly ensures the air is always being cleaned. Using a timer or auto mode can also be effective.
